Yildiz Ceramic Studio

Preserving Ottoman pottery traditions in the heart of Istanbul. Founded by a master potter, the studio specializes in Iznik style tiles, mosaic bowls, and decorative plates. Artisans hand throw each vessel and hand paint classical motifs—tulips, carnations, and arabesques—using underglaze pigments. Their pieces adorn boutique hotels and private residences across Europe and the Middle East.
Yildiz Ceramic’s weekly schedule balances commissions and public workshops. Early mornings focus on wheel throwing, while afternoons are dedicated to painting and glazing. Kiln firings occur overnight in electric and gas kilns, carefully monitored to achieve the signature glossy finish. The studio also collaborates with interior designers for bespoke installations—wall sized tile murals and functional art pieces—highlighting the rich heritage of Turkish ceramics in contemporary interiors.
